Castell d’Almudèfer
Castell d’Almudèfer is a ruins in Caseres Municipality, Tarragona, Catalonia. Castell d’Almudèfer is situated nearby to the peak Turó d’Almudèfer, as well as near the church Santa Anna d’Almudèfer.Places of Interest Nearby

Arens de Lledó or Arenys de Lledó is a municipality located in the Matarraña/Matarranya comarca, province of Teruel, Aragon, Spain. According to the 2008 census, the municipality has a population of 217 inhabitants, and covers an area of 34.27 square kilometres. Arens de Lledó is situated 4 km south of Castell d’Almudèfer.

Calaceite or Calaceit is a municipality located in the Matarraña comarca, in the province of Teruel, Aragon,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ality has a population of 1,145 inhabitants. Calaceite Municipality is situated 7 km west of Castell d’Almudèfer.
